Scaling Your Infrastructure: Essential Data Center Products for Growth
Introduction
The digital landscape is rapidly evolving, and businesses are constantly seeking ways to scale their infrastructure to meet growing demands. But what does it mean to scale, and why is it so crucial? Essentially, scaling infrastructure involves expanding a business’s capacity to handle increased data, users, and services without compromising performance. This is where data centers come into play—these complex systems form the backbone of modern IT operations. In this article, we’ll explore the essential data center products that support infrastructure growth and how they contribute to scalability.
Understanding Data Centers
What is a Data Center?
At its core, a data center is a facility where an organization’s IT operations and equipment are housed. It’s a secure environment with the necessary infrastructure to manage, store, and process large volumes of data. But not all data centers are created equal. Some are designed for large enterprises, while others are smaller and cater to specific business needs.
Different Types of Data Centers
Data centers come in various forms, including enterprise data centers, colocation centers, cloud data centers, and edge data centers. Enterprise data centers are owned and operated by a single organization. Colocation centers, on the other hand, are shared facilities where multiple businesses can rent space. Cloud data centers are virtualized environments where infrastructure is hosted remotely, while edge data centers are distributed to bring computing resources closer to end-users.
Key Components of a Scalable Data Center
Servers and Virtualization
Servers are the heart of any data center. They handle the processing tasks that power applications and services. To scale efficiently, many organizations turn to virtualization, which allows multiple virtual machines to run on a single physical server. This approach maximizes hardware utilization and provides flexibility for scaling.
Networking Infrastructure
Networking is the connective tissue of a data center. This includes routers, switches, and firewalls, all working together to ensure data flows seamlessly between servers and external networks. Scalable networking infrastructure is essential for supporting increased traffic and connectivity demands.
Power Supply and Cooling Systems
Data centers consume massive amounts of power, making reliable power supply critical for scalability. Uninterruptible power supplies (UPS) and backup generators ensure continuous operation. Additionally, effective cooling systems are vital to prevent overheating, which can lead to equipment failure and downtime.
Data Storage Solutions
Data storage is another crucial component of a scalable data center. Solutions like Storage Area Networks (SAN), Network Attached Storage (NAS), and Direct Attached Storage (DAS) offer varying levels of capacity and performance. As data volumes grow, having scalable storage solutions becomes paramount.
Scaling Infrastructure for Business Growth
The Role of Cloud Computing
Cloud computing has revolutionized the way businesses scale their infrastructure. With cloud services, organizations can quickly add or reduce capacity as needed without significant upfront costs. This flexibility allows for scalable growth while minimizing hardware investments.
Hybrid Cloud Solutions
Hybrid cloud solutions combine on-premises data centers with cloud-based resources. This approach offers the best of both worlds, enabling businesses to scale their infrastructure while maintaining control over sensitive data. It also allows for more efficient load distribution across different environments.
Edge Computing and Its Impact on Scalability
Edge computing is gaining popularity as a way to improve scalability. By processing data closer to the source, edge computing reduces latency and bandwidth requirements. This is particularly useful for applications that require real-time processing or operate in remote locations.
Data Center Products for Scaling
Rack Servers vs. Blade Servers
When it comes to servers, businesses have options. Rack servers are individual units that can be installed in a standard server rack, allowing for easy scalability by adding more servers as needed. Blade servers are more compact and can fit multiple server modules in a single chassis, making them ideal for high-density environments.
Networking Equipment: Routers, Switches, and Firewalls
Scaling a data center requires robust networking equipment. Routers direct traffic between networks, switches connect devices within a network, and firewalls ensure security by controlling access. Investing in high-performance networking gear is key to maintaining scalability.
Storage Solutions: SAN, NAS, and DAS
Different storage solutions offer varying levels of scalability. SAN is designed for large-scale data storage and allows multiple servers to access shared storage resources. NAS provides a centralized storage system accessible over a network, while DAS connects storage devices directly to servers. Each solution has its benefits, depending on the organization’s scalability needs.
Power and Cooling Systems for Data Centers
Power and cooling systems play a crucial role in data center scalability. UPS systems provide backup power, ensuring data centers remain operational during outages. Efficient cooling systems, such as liquid cooling, help manage the heat generated by densely packed equipment, reducing the risk of downtime due to overheating.
Best Practices for Scaling Data Centers
Capacity Planning and Future Proofing
To ensure scalability, businesses should engage in capacity planning, which involves forecasting future infrastructure needs. This allows for proactive scaling and helps avoid overloading the data center. Future proofing ensures that the infrastructure can accommodate new technologies and business growth.
Load Balancing and Redundancy
Load balancing is essential for distributing workloads evenly across servers, reducing the risk of bottlenecks. Redundancy, such as having backup servers or power supplies, adds an extra layer of security and helps maintain high availability.
Security and Compliance
Scaling a data center requires a focus on security and compliance. As infrastructure grows, so does the potential attack surface. Implementing robust security measures and ensuring compliance with industry standards is critical for protecting sensitive data.
Monitoring and Management Tools
To keep a scaled data center running smoothly, monitoring and management tools are indispensable. These tools provide real-time insights into system performance, allowing IT teams to detect and address issues before they become major problems.
Challenges in Scaling Data Centers
Infrastructure Costs and Budgeting
Scaling a data center can be expensive. Costs include hardware, software, power, and cooling systems. Effective budgeting and cost management are essential to ensure that infrastructure scaling aligns with business objectives.
Environmental Considerations
Data centers consume significant energy, leading to environmental concerns. Businesses should consider sustainable practices when scaling infrastructure, such as using energy-efficient equipment and renewable energy sources.
Maintaining High Availability and Uptime
As data centers scale, maintaining high availability and uptime becomes more challenging. Redundant systems and robust failover processes are crucial to minimize downtime and ensure business continuity.
Conclusion
Scaling infrastructure is a complex but necessary endeavor for growing businesses. Data centers provide the backbone for this scalability, offering the flexibility and capacity to handle increased demands. By understanding the key components of a scalable data center and implementing best practices, businesses can ensure their infrastructure grows in step with their goals. The future of data center scalability is bright, with technologies like cloud computing and edge computing driving innovation and efficiency.